1. Basic Audiometry Equipment: a. Audiometers: These devices are the cornerstone of any audiology practice and are used to measure a person's hearing ability. China offers a wide range of audiometers, ranging from conventional diagnostic audiometers to portable and wireless models. b. Tympanometers: Tympanometers are used to assess the functioning of the middle ear. Chinese manufacturers have developed advanced tympanometers that can quickly and accurately measure middle ear impedance, providing valuable insights for diagnosing conditions such as otitis media.
2. Screening and Diagnostic Equipment: a. Otoacoustic Emission (OAE) Systems: OAE systems are used for hearing screening in newborns, infants, and adults. China offers OAE systems with various features like multiple probe options and advanced algorithms for accurate screening. b. Auditory Brainstem Response (ABR) Systems: ABR systems are used to assess the integrity of the auditory pathway. Chinese manufacturers provide ABR systems with high signal-to-noise ratios and user-friendly interfaces, making them an essential tool in diagnosing hearing disorders.
3. Specialized Audiometry Equipment: a. Real Ear Measurement (REM) Systems: REM systems are used to measure the sound pressure level in a patient's ear canal. Chinese REM systems integrate seamlessly with traditional audiometers, enabling accurate verification of hearing aid fittings and aiding in the selection of appropriate amplification settings. b. Central Auditory Processing (CAP) Systems: CAP systems assess how the brain processes auditory stimuli. These systems are crucial for diagnosing Central Auditory Processing Disorder (CAPD) in children and adults. China offers CAP systems with advanced features like automated protocols and comprehensive test batteries.
